Why File for Bankruptcy?

There are several reasons why you may want to consider filing for bankruptcy. If you are unable to pay your debts, you may be able to eliminate your debt through bankruptcy. Some people also choose to file for bankruptcy as a way to stop foreclosure or repossession.

When you file for bankruptcy, your assets are protected from collection. This means that your creditors cannot sue you or harass you in an attempt to collect on your debt. Filing for bankruptcy can also stop wage garnishment or vehicle repossession.
